When it comes to selecting art collection insurance, there are a few key factors to consider. The first is the value of your collection – make sure that you have an accurate appraisal of each piece in your collection to ensure that you have the right level of coverage. It is also important to review the terms and conditions of the insurance policy carefully, paying close attention to any exclusions or limitations that may apply.
Additionally, it is important to work with a reputable insurance provider who specializes in art collection insurance. Look for a provider with experience in insuring art collections, as well as a track record of providing excellent customer service and claims assistance.
